As June 1 looms, NHL teams are getting serious about who will be hired for their hockey office openings.

PITT STOP FOR DUBAS?

The heads of the Fenway Group, which owns the Penguins among other pro sports interests worldwide, were at the Monaco Grand Prix on the weekend and expected to settle the GM question this week. Columbus GM Jarmo Kekalainen will be headed home to deal with a coaching vacancy. Andrew Brunette, who was in line in Florida last year before it opted for Paul Maurice to replace Joel Quenneville, is getting mentioned there amid rumours the Jackets will also make a big pitch to Patrick Roy to get back under the NHL big top.
